5 Essential Tips for Creating a Productive Home Office Environment
Creating a productive home office environment is essential for maximizing efficiency and focus. Here are 5 essential tips to transform your workspace.
- Choose the Right Location: Select a quiet space in your home that is free from distractions. Consider factors like natural light and room temperature to enhance your comfort.
- Invest in Ergonomic Furniture: A comfortable chair and a height-adjustable desk can make a world of difference. Proper ergonomics help prevent strain and keep you productive throughout the day.
- Stay Organized: Clutter can significantly hinder productivity. Utilize organizers, such as shelves and filing cabinets, to keep your workspace tidy and conducive to work.
- Establish a Routine: Set specific work hours and stick to them. A consistent schedule not only improves focus but also helps separate your professional and personal life.
- Optimize Technology: Ensure you have reliable internet and access to necessary tools and software. A seamless tech setup allows you to work efficiently and stay connected with colleagues.

How to Turn Your Home Workspace into a Relaxing Oasis
Creating a serene and productive environment in your home workspace is essential for maintaining focus and reducing stress. To turn your home workspace into a relaxing oasis, start by decluttering your desk. A tidy space contributes to a clearer mind. You can enhance the atmosphere by incorporating elements of nature, such as houseplants or a small water feature, which are known to lower stress levels. Additionally, consider investing in comfortable furniture and ergonomically designed accessories, as comfort plays a critical role in your overall work experience.
Lighting is another crucial component when transforming your workspace. Opt for soft, warm lighting that mimics natural daylight, as this can help to create a calm ambiance. You can also add scented candles or essential oil diffusers with fragrances like lavender or eucalyptus to provide a therapeutic aspect to your environment. Don't forget to personalize your space with artwork or photographs that inspire you, making it not just a workspace, but a true relaxing oasis.
What Key Features Make Your Home Office Feel Like a Sanctuary?
Creating a home office that feels like a sanctuary requires careful consideration of key features that foster productivity and well-being. First, the layout and organization of your workspace play a crucial role. Ensure that your desk is placed near a window to maximize natural light, which not only boosts mood but also improves focus. Furthermore, incorporating plants can enhance air quality and bring a sense of calm to your environment. Aim to declutter your workspace by using organizers and storage solutions that create a clean and serene atmosphere.
Another essential aspect of a home office sanctuary is the choice of furnishings. A comfortable chair is vital for long hours of work, so invest in an ergonomic option that supports your posture. Pair it with a desk that suits your style, whether it's modern or rustic, to create a space that inspires you. Lastly, don't overlook the importance of color. Selecting calming tones, such as soft blues or greens, can influence your mood and make your workspace feel inviting. By thoughtfully combining these elements, you can transform your home office into a true retreat.
